📖 Overview

Massad Ayoob is an internationally recognized firearms and self-defense instructor who has written extensively on personal defense, law enforcement, and the responsible use of firearms. His career spans over four decades during which he has served as a police captain, authored more than a dozen books, and trained both civilians and law enforcement personnel. Ayoob founded the Lethal Force Institute in 1981 (now known as Massad Ayoob Group) and developed training programs focusing on the judicious use of deadly force. His work has been particularly influential in examining the psychological, physiological, and legal aspects of armed encounters and self-defense situations. As an expert witness in firearms and use-of-force cases, Ayoob has testified in state and federal courts across the United States. His books, including "In the Gravest Extreme" and "Deadly Force: Understanding Your Right to Self Defense," are considered fundamental texts in the field of armed self-defense. Throughout his career, Ayoob has contributed regularly to major firearms publications including American Handgunner, Combat Handguns, and Guns magazine. His teaching methodology, known as the "Stressfire" system, has influenced modern defensive firearms training techniques.

📚 Books by Massad Ayoob

In the Gravest Extreme: The Role of the Firearm in Personal Protection (1980) Comprehensive guide on armed self-defense and the legal implications of using deadly force.

The Truth About Self Protection (1983) Detailed examination of various personal defense methods, including both armed and unarmed techniques.

StressFire (1986) Technical manual on combat shooting methods under high-stress conditions.

Hit the White Part (1986) Instructions on fundamental marksmanship and shooting techniques.

The Semi-Automatic Pistol in Police Service and Self Defense (1987) Analysis of semi-automatic pistols' role in law enforcement and civilian defense applications.

Fundamentals of Modern Police Impact Weapons (1988) Technical guide on the use of batons and other impact weapons in law enforcement.

Gun Digest Book of Combat Handgunnery (2002) Detailed overview of defensive handgun techniques and training methods.

The Gun Digest Book of Concealed Carry (2007) Guide to legal, practical, and tactical aspects of carrying concealed firearms.

Combat Shooting with Massad Ayoob (2011) Technical instruction on advanced combat shooting techniques and tactical applications.

Deadly Force: Understanding Your Right to Self Defense (2014) Analysis of legal frameworks and practical considerations in self-defense situations.

Gun Safety in the Home (2014) Guide to firearm storage, handling, and safety protocols in domestic settings.
